Anyone use a Skinner rear barrel sight that fits NEF and Henry single shot? Has anyone used the Dovetail attachment ramp for the front sight? If so how did this work for you? What was the front sight height used with the ramp? Thinking about this for Single shot in 30-30.

I have them both on mine. I think it depends on your caliber/cartridge as to whether or not you can use the factory front sight. I have a 44 Mag, and the factory front sight definitely would not have worked on mine. Even after I filed Skinner's supplied front blade way down, it was still well higher than what Henry put on it.

The sights work very well; I'm pleased with how it's set up. If I had my druthers, I might have put some half wings/ears on the back to protect that single aperture stem sticking up, but it seems to be fine as is. I'll add some pics below shortly.

Skinner makes some really good stuff. I also like their front ramp shotgun bead. I bought and installed a couple of those; that's a really nice add-on. I ended up with a "total package" on the Skinner sights. The last thing I added was that elevation lock for the aperture. I didn't consider it at first, but, after I went through a few zeroing trials, I found out just how much drop that 44 Mag round was going to have, and I put it on for quick changes in case of a max-ord adjustment at mid-range. The front site blade is filed WAY down from what they sent, but I was advised that that would probably be the case.
